No Annual Fee Credit Cards

You can have a credit card that doesn’t cost you anything! This cant be right you’re saying? but if you use these no annual fee credit cards appropriately, you can enjoy all the benefits these cards have to offer without paying for them directly.

Most credit cards come with some sort of fee, but no annual fee credit cards do away with fees and still have competitive interest rates. If your credit card doesn’t stack up against “no annual fee credit cards” you could be paying more than you should for the privilege of using your credit card every day.

I said before if your use no annual fee credit cards appropriately you can save money, a credit card fee is an expense you pay for the use of a credit card, if you leave amounts owing on your credit card from month to month you will incur a interest rate fee for borrowing the money but the credit card itself doesn’t cost you at all.

You should not use your credit card to borrow amounts you can’t pay back after a few months; some financial debts belong under personal loans which can provide a much lower interest rates and are designed to be payed off over years if required, reducing monthly repayments drastically.
